BWW Review: NOT ABOUT HEROES: Drama at its Best in Kansas City

The two-person play Not About Heroes opened Friday November 14 at the Metropolitan Ensemble Theatre in Kansas City, Mo. Due to technical difficulties the opening of the play was delayed a week from November 6. Bob Paisley, a founding member of the theater, directs the thought provoking dramatic World War I piece. Audiences that view the two-act drama as poetry in motion will insure themselves of a very entertaining evening.

NOT ABOUT HEROES UK Tour Opens this Week

In Autumn 2014 Blackeyed Theatre Company tours Stephen MacDonald's Not About Heroes to over forty theatres across the UK . Marking the centenary of the beginning of The First World War, this major revival of MacDonald's play, about the poets Siegfried Sassoon and Wilfred Owen, performs from 10 September until 6 December 2014.

Cincinnati Playhouse Adds Reading of NOT ABOUT HEROES, 3/24

The Cincinnati Playhouse in the Park will present a reading of Stephen MacDonald's drama about the real-life friendship of two World War I soldier poets, NOT ABOUT HEROES, at 7 p.m. Monday, March 24. The reading is being offered in collaboration with the Cincinnati Remembers World War I series, the Cincinnati Opera's citywide series of events in commemoration of the 100th anniversary of the onset of World War I.
